Take This Epic Hot Air Balloon Ride Over The Grand Canyon Of The East Before You Die

One of the best state parks in America, New York’s Letchworth State Park is also known to many as the Grand Canyon of the East. The popular state park’s most frequently talked about features include the three major waterfalls that you can find cascading along the Genesee River as well as the jaw-dropping hiking trails that you can explore here. Here’s a new way to see these breathtaking landscapes; keep reading to find out how you can get a view of this incredible state park from above.

What’s the most unforgettable hot-air balloon ride that you’ve ever taken in America? Share with us your favorite spots and photos from your own adventures in the comments section!